MOTHER DAIRY
Serial 88705077 · Principal Register
Dead · Cancelled

Owner: 1228300 Alberta Ltd
Class 029 - Meats & Processed Foods
Filed Nov 25, 2019
Registered Jun 30, 2020

The record shows that the mark “MOTHER DAIRY” was registered on the Principal Register on June 30, 2020, but it was cancelled under Section 18 by the Trademark Trial and Appeal Board on May 6, 2026. The owner listed is 1228300 Alberta Ltd, a limited company organized in Canada. The goods covered by the registration were a range of dairy products, including butter, cheese, yogurt, milk powder, and related items, all classified under class 029. Because the cancellation was due to a Section 18 finding, the mark no longer has enforceable rights, and the record does not give the owner control over every use of the wording. No opposition, extension, or court action appears in the supplied history, so there is no visible enforcement activity. For someone considering a similar name, the closest concern would be in the dairy food space; outside that, the record offers no indication of protection.
